CLARKSBURG, W.Va. (WBOY) — A restaurant that is a staple in downtown Clarksburg is closing.

My Mother’s Daughter wrote in a Facebook post Monday that the restaurant’s last day open in its downtown Clarksburg location will be Friday, Aug. 19, and that it will also be closed on Tuesday, Aug. 16 so that owner Stephanie Wyatt can adopt four boys.

Wyatt wrote that the closure will not be a goodbye, but a “see ya later,” because she has made the decision in an effort to become more available to her family and friends, but she will “continue to do things privately and in smaller increments out of [her] home.”
